Physical properties

Blue-gray, fine-grained to subtly crystalline surface with strong satiny reflections, possibly from polishing or cleavage planes. Labradorite has Mohs hardness 6–6.5 and vitreous luster; slate has hardness about 3–5.5 and dull to silky luster.

Formation & geological history

Labradorite crystallizes in mafic igneous rocks as molten material cools; slate forms when shale undergoes low-grade metamorphism. Geological ages vary widely depending on source locality.

Uses & applications

Labradorite is used as an ornamental stone, cabochon, and decorative tile; slate is used for roofing, flooring, paving, and architectural surfaces. Value depends strongly on color play, pattern, size, and finish.

Geological facts

The bright blue flashes characteristic of labradorite are caused by light interference within closely stacked feldspar lamellae. Slate commonly shows planar foliation and splits into thin sheets.

Field identification & locations

Check for blue, green, or gold iridescent flashes, feldspar-like hardness, and cleavage to support labradorite; flat foliation and easy splitting favor slate. Common sources include Madagascar, Finland, Canada, Norway, and India.
